Textbooks and Other Course Reserves Items

Our course reserves service provides students with access through the library to many textbooks, articles, films, and more that are assigned in classes.

General Information For Students

Our physical course reserves items are available to borrow for short periods of time. These items are located in the library; ask at the help desk near the library entrance.

Our electronic course reserves (also called e-reserves) include electronic journal articles, e-books, scanned selections from books, and more. These are available through the Libraries’ e-reserves system and also through your courses in Canvas.

Need help locating reserves items for your classes? Contact us at UL-LEHIGH-VAL@LISTS.PSU.EDU or 610-285-5027.

General Information For Instructors

Making course materials available through the library’s course reserves service helps reduce students’ financial burdens and barriers. Instructors may put material on reserve, both physically in the library and electronically through through the Libraries’ e-reserves system. Course reserves items can include library-owned and library-licensed materials, as well as instructors' personal copies. Scan and Print

A Scannx scanner with touch screen interface and ability to send files to USB, email, or Google Drive is available in the library.

All current students, faculty and staff can print to the network printer located in the west wing of the library. This printer makes single and double-sided, black-and-white prints. (A color printer is available in room 220). Students receive 110 sheets free each semester. Additional sheets may be purchased.
